NEC Tuner adds TV signals to public displays

NEC has launched the Tuner, which gives users DVB-T, IPTV and analogue signals via the option slot on a display, adding a wider range of content feed methods. This product in being aimed at digital signage, education and corporate in-house information and entertainment markets.

Having the Tuner integrated as an option slot means the user does not need any additional cables or external devices and can operate the tuner using the display’s remote control. Channels can also be changed via LAN through the built-in HTTP server which is helpful for central control of multiple screens.
